Automatic Transmission
Campaign 18V492000 | 26/07/2018
If the transmission weld fails, the vehicle will stop moving, increasing the risk of a crash.
Chrysler will notify owners, and dealers will replace the transmission, free of charge. The recall is expected to begin September 2018. Owners may contact Chrysler customer service at 1-800-853-1403. Chrysler's number for this recall is U85.
Axle Shaft
Campaign 18V493000 | 26/07/2018
If the axle shaft disengages from the CV joint, the vehicle will have a loss of drive or allow the vehicle to move while in the "Park" position. Either condition may increase the risk of a crash.
Chrysler will notify owners, and dealers will replace the left or right halfshaft assembly, free of charge. The recall began September 18, 2018. Owners may contact Chrysler customer service at 1-800-853-1403. Chrysler's number for this recall is U80.

Front Underhood
Campaign 18V524000 | 09/08/2018
A vehicle stall can increase the risk of a crash.
Chrysler will notify owners, and dealers will replace the powertrain control module, free of charge. The recall began October 2, 2018. Owners may contact Chrysler customer service at 1-800-853-1403. Chrysler's number for this recall is U87.

Rear/Other
Campaign 17V542000 | 31/08/2017
Inadvertent unlatching of the left outboard seat belt can increase the risk of injury in the event of a crash.
Chrysler will notify owners, and dealers will install a shorter second-row seat belt buckle, free of charge. The recall began October 26, 2017. Owners may contact Chrysler customer service at 1-800-853-1403. Chrysler's number for this recall is T54.
Camera
Campaign 19V886000 | 12/12/2019
The lingering rearview image can distract the driver, increasing the risk of a crash.
Chrysler will notify owners, and dealers will update the radio software, free of charge. The recall began January 9, 2020. Owners may contact Chrysler customer service at 1-800-853-1403. Chrysler's number for this recall is VE2.
